What Kinds of Meat are Offered at H Pot Korean BBQ?

H Pot typically features a wide array of high-quality meats for grilling. Expect to find options such as:

  • Bulgogi: Thinly sliced marinated beef, often seasoned with soy sauce, garlic, ginger, and sesame oil. It's a classic Korean BBQ staple, known for its tender texture and sweet and savory flavor profile.
  • Galbi: Marinated short ribs, typically thicker and richer than bulgogi. Galbi is prized for its melt-in-your-mouth tenderness and intense flavor. You might find both beef and pork galbi on the menu.
  • Samgyeopsal: Thinly sliced pork belly, a popular choice for its rich, fatty flavor and satisfying texture. Often enjoyed with various wraps and side dishes.
  • Dak Bulgogi: Marinated chicken, offering a lighter alternative to beef bulgogi. The marinade frequently incorporates gochujang (Korean chili paste) for a spicy kick.
  • Other options: Depending on location and availability, you might also encounter other meats like marinated duck or seafood options integrated into the BBQ experience.

What Types of Hot Pot Broths Does H Pot Offer?

H Pot's hot pot selection is equally impressive, boasting a range of flavorful broths to suit different tastes. Common choices include:

  • Kimchi Stew: A spicy and tangy broth made with fermented kimchi, pork, and vegetables. It's a flavorful and warming option.
  • Beef Bone Broth: A rich and savory broth simmered for hours to extract maximum flavor from beef bones. This provides a hearty base for your hot pot ingredients.
  • Spicy Seafood Broth: A fiery and aromatic broth packed with seafood flavors and a generous dose of chili peppers. This option is perfect for seafood lovers who enjoy a kick.
  • Miso Broth: A milder and more subtly flavored broth, perfect for those who prefer a less spicy experience.
  • Other variations: Some H Pot locations might offer seasonal or specialty broths, adding to the variety.

What Vegetables and Other Ingredients are Typically Included?

Beyond the meats and broths, a plethora of fresh ingredients completes the H Pot experience. You'll typically find an extensive selection of:

  • Assorted vegetables: Mushrooms, spinach, onions, zucchini, carrots, and other seasonal vegetables are common additions.
  • Noodles: Glass noodles (dangmyeon), ramen noodles, and other noodle varieties are frequently available.
  • Tofu: Various types of tofu, adding protein and texture to the hot pot.
  • Seafood: Shrimp, mussels, clams, and fish cakes often feature prominently in hot pot selections, particularly in seafood-centric broths.
  • Dumplings: Various types of Korean dumplings (mandu) often enhance the hot pot experience.

What Sides and Appetizers Does H Pot Serve?

To complement your BBQ and hot pot selections, H Pot likely offers a range of traditional Korean side dishes (banchan) and appetizers:

  • Kimchi: Various types of kimchi are almost always available.
  • Pickled vegetables: A variety of pickled vegetables offer contrasting flavors and textures.
  • Japchae: Glass noodles stir-fried with vegetables and meat.
  • Other appetizers: Depending on location and menu, other Korean appetizers might be available.
